USS Defiant

By Darian Kovach




This is my T.M Lindsey 1/1400 USS Defiant. Sadly, I do not believe he makes them anymore. It was 5 pieces (body, 2 nacelles, the nose and a docking clamp). It looked great right out of the box, with very little flash to clean up. The detail on it is incredibly crisp. Lots of places to lavish detail on it.

The main body is Tamiya Flat White mixed with Tamiya Medium Blue. The end result was a very cool grey. Then I hand painted the individual panels (I have a biiiig magnifying glass), by mixing more of the medium blue with the flat white. Each shade up I added more blue, until the darkest, when I added Tamiya flat black to it. I then mixed a touch of black with Khaki for the escape pods. I used a combination of the Lindsey decals (the front sensors, specifically) and after market EXCELLENT JT Graphic decals.

Finally, after I sealed it, I mixed chalk pastels with water and "washed it", bringing out the panel lines. I also did the Windows with a similar wash. I sealed that in, and did a matte coat. From there I took the pastels and weathered away. I wanted a dirty, grimy ship that looks like it was a war horse. I think I came pretty close.
